Clairin is a category of cane juice Rhum from Haiti. Produced similarly to the more well known Rhum Agricole of Martinique but not a part of the French AOC designation. They are most commonly produced by small farmer distillers in the countryside of Haiti rather than at more formal commercial distilleries.

Clairin Vaval is produced by Fritz Vaval in the coastal village of Cavaillon in the southeast of Haiti. He cultivates a variety of cane called Madame Meuze which  Luca Gargano, found of Velier believes to be the finest varietal for Rhum production. It is fresh and sea-kissed with some sharp botanical notes. 

Importer Notes:
Here, Fritz Vaval runs the Distillerie Arawaks which has been owned by his family since 1947.

Fritz owns 20 hectares of land planted with the Madame Meuze cane variety, cultivated naturally, without the use if chemical fertilisers or pesticides. Clairin Vaval is produced from pure sugar cane juice fermented naturally with wild yeasts and distilled on a small pot still that Fritz made himself, powered by the steam engine of an old locomotive.

Clairin Vaval tastes of its region, with aromatics of salty sea air, beach sand, and rich botanicals.
